Transaction 0ba883433567ecbcabe1b967bf29c6f09af61250f079e0feffdc083e8022f9e5
1 Input
1 Outputs
- 0ba883433567ecbcabe1b967bf29c6f09af61250f079e0feffdc083e8022f9e5:0
value 1569630
address 3HNk26EEkae3v4TUmmQaFJ9eLVAdFnMTbs